Cupid and the swan — Giulio Romano|Wenceslaus Hollar

Cupid standing with legs spread, embracing the neck of a swan. From a series of six plates, etched by Hollar after drawings by Giulio Romano from the collection of Nicolas Lanier, designs for stucco medallions at the Palazzo Te in Mantua.
